Notorious carjacker attacks prosecutor during court procession

Chiredzi – There was drama at Chiredzi magistrate court last Friday when Clemence Mumanyi, a notorious car thief known for the cold-bloodied murder of a member of the Central Intelligence Organisation (CIO) in Chiredzi in 2008 and was given a death penalty by the High Court, attacked Moreblessing Rusere, a regional court prosecutor to avenge his conviction on 13 other cases.
The gallery was left in shock when Mumanyi (32), who is of no fixed abode, jumped out of the accused’s box before he grabbed a chair and threw it at Rusere who managed to duck and scamper for safety. 
The court was then adjourned only to reconvene some moments later in the absence of Mumanyi and in accordance with section 194 of the Criminal Law and Codification Act which allows the court to proceed with the accused in absentia if he/she fails to cooperate.
Led by Magistrate Judith Zuyu, the court heard that on July 21, 2008 Mumanyi, in the company of some of his accomplices went to Khumbula Complex in Chiredzi where he used violent threats before stealing a Mercedes Benz with registration number AAJ 0268.
In another count, Mumanyi allegedly went to a Chiredzi rural and town council workshop on October 26, 2008 where he used an AK47 rifle and 9 mm pistol to scare council guards before making away with a Hino truck; registration number 837 28ZN, a motorcycle and a welding machine.
In yet another count, Mumanyi is accused of going to section 7 Chilonga armed with a 9 mm pistol and stole a UD 96 truck with registration number AAH 9917.
Mumanyi also faces a myriad of other charges including smuggling, robbery, possession of dangerous weapons and theft.
The matter was later postponed to a later date since other witnesses failed to attend the court session.news
